defending little blind when structure is 2 chip, 3 chip.
 
Hi
It’s been over a year since I posted on this particular forum, so I’m sorry if this is a redundant question.

I need a general defending range for the small blind in a 2 chip, 3 chip structure game. In normal blind structures, I just 3 bet or fold the little blind against a stealer with hands like any pocket pair, Qjo, A8o, etc.

When defending the big blind, I’ll call a steal raiser with hands like 34s, 86o, 64s, etc. It seems like when my little blind is 2/3's of the big blind, that I ought to be able to call with a range looser than what I would 3 bet with, but tighter then my loosest defense range in the big blind.

Any suggestions?

I think this mostly depends on the BB. In a normal blind structure, you're wanting to 3bet because your equity is higher HU than 3 handed with pretty much every hand you would consider defending the SB with, so you want to raise to try to isolate the stealer. With the 2/3 structure, you're going to want to defend a wider range of hands (probably around 30% or more(I haven't done the math tho)) and you're going to want to put in a raise if you have a good chance of shutting out the BB. If the BB adjusts to your wide 3betting range and he starts CCing or capping light, you're probably going to want to start cold calling your weaker suited hands that play well multiway. Once you start cold calling, you're going to want to flat call sometimes with AA, KK, and AKs for balance.

Same range to defend vs a raise, 3 bet and force the bb out as you would in the normal structure. To 3 bet or fold you need a fairly big hand to play in the first place, the good news is when you do win you'll win slightly more money. The difference in this structure is that you defend with virtually any 2 cards against limpers and of course, as you state above, you can defend the bb slightly more liberally.
